Rapid urbanization and climate variability have significantly increased the frequency and intensity of urban flooding in Hyderabad, India. The city’s existing stormwater drainage infrastructure, originally designed for a much smaller urban footprint, struggles to accommodate present-day runoff volumes during intense monsoon events. Recurrent flooding has resulted in substantial economic losses, infrastructure damage, and disruption to urban mobility across several flood-prone zones within the metropolitan area. This research examines the potential role of strategically designed stormwater canal systems as an integrated solution for urban flood mitigation in Hyderabad. Through spatial analysis of flood-prone areas, drainage infrastructure gaps, and watershed characteristics, the study identifies key locations where canal-based stormwater conveyance systems could significantly improve flood resilience. The research also evaluates international precedents in urban flood management, including canal and integrated water infrastructure models implemented in cities such as Singapore, Tokyo, and Kuala Lumpur. The findings suggest that expanding and restructuring Hyderabad’s stormwater network through dedicated canal corridors—particularly along major drainage basins and rapidly urbanizing western zones—could enhance runoff management, reduce surface flooding, and support long-term climate-resilient urban planning. The study further outlines policy recommendations, infrastructure strategies, and priority intervention zones that could guide future municipal planning initiatives. By integrating hydrological analysis, urban infrastructure assessment, and comparative case studies, this research contributes to the broader discourse on sustainable stormwater management in rapidly growing metropolitan regions. The proposed framework highlights how stormwater canals can transform floodwater from a recurring urban hazard into a managed component of resilient urban water systems.
